Output 89a2bea4279fc398ec88cf4b59a6a26bd6007f04d9bc162d7baa0ff90a0d08f9:0

value
52902463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b0da6b656cb958ee95840fe152fe8e3063ca2b OP_EQUAL
address
MVkXbFf37Ab8GgseJfniqquNeKKSWq8Edr
transaction
89a2bea4279fc398ec88cf4b59a6a26bd6007f04d9bc162d7baa0ff90a0d08f9
spent
true